Glyn School in Epsom is looking for a passionate and ambitious Teacher of Psychology to join a high-achieving environment. This position offers a permanent contract with full-time hours focusing on developing effective teaching strategies that ensure excellent student outcomes.
Ideal candidates will have outstanding teaching skills and be committed to students’ learning and welfare. The school emphasizes professional development, staff well-being, and offers a rich community environment to inspire growth and learning.
